You begin with placing the chamber of the cuisinart ice cream maker in the freezer for approximately 8 hours before making the ice cream. This is time enough for the liquid that is inside the chamber walls to freeze completely. After it has become completely frozen, the chilling chamber is then positioned on the top of the powered base. A mixing paddle is situated inside the chamber. To keep the chamber in place, a transparent covering locks on its base. Once the machine has been powered on, you can start by placing the ingredients inside the chamber.

As the mixer churns, you can put in your ingredients through the opening, which is usually at the chilling chambers top. Start by pouring in the cream, sugar, vanilla and milk which form the base of your ice cream. This machine is perfect for creating soft confections as the churner traps air. It is therefore hard to make dense desserts using the machine.

The process of churning depends on the evenness desired. For the full, it would take 20 to 40 minutes while it may be shorter for frozen drinks or yoghurts. You can add some chocolate chips, fruit, nuts and any other items before the dessert reaches the desired consistency. When the process is finished, use a plastic or a wooden utensil to scoop out the dessert into the storage container. The gadget can make up to 11/2 quarts of ice cream and you should therefore have a large storage container.
